As. Dighe et al., Extracting CKM phases and B-s-(B)over-bar-(s) mixing parameters from angular distributions of non-leptonic B decays, EUR PHY J C, 6(4), 1999, pp. 647-662
Suggestions for efficiently determining the lifetimes and mass difference o
f the light and heavy B-s mesons (B-s(L) , B-s(H)) from B-s --> J/psi phi,
Ds*+Ds*- decays are given. Using appropriate weighting functions for thf an
gular distributions of the decay products (moment analysis), one can extrac
t (Gamma(H); Gamma(L); Delta m)(Bs). Such a moment analysis allows the dete
rmination of the relative magnitudes and phases of the CP-odd and CP even d
ecay amplitudes. Efficient determinations of CP-violating effects occuring
in B-s --> J/psi phi, Ds*+Ds*- are discussed in the light of a possible wid
th difference (Delta Gamma)(Bs), and the utility of this method for B --> J
/psi K*, D-s(*+)(D) over bar* decays is noted. Since our approach is very g
eneral, it can in principle be applied to all kinds of angular distribution
s and allows the determination of all relevant observables, including funda
mental CKM (Cabibbo-Kobayashi-Maskawa) parameters: as well as tests of vari
ous aspects of the factorization hypothesis. Explicit angular distributions
and weighting functions are given, and the general method that can be used
for any angular distribution is indicated.
